CICELY SADLER (nee WILSON) August 18, 1920 - June 20, 2015 Cicely Sadler passed peacefully at age 94 at Seven Oaks Hospital in Winnipeg on June 20, 2015. She was born to Sarah and James Wilson on August 18, 1920 in Swan River Manitoba. She was the wife of the late Lyman Sadler. Cicely is survived by her children Marje (Boris) Wlad, Mim (Bob) Whitely, Robert (Bev) Sadler, Stan (Corinne) Sadler and Sarah (Tom) Santiago, grandchildren Brock, Kerri, Brad, Ryan, Rhett, Rory, Chloe, Leah, Kenna, Michael, Andre, Stephen and Matt. Also great-grandchildren Rain, Luci, Brennan, Brody, Mack, Brady, Addie, Rowan, Rossi, Taryn and Lucas. She leaves behind sisters Sheila Cotton, Vera Parker and Iris Stinson, in-laws Sam and Bernice Sadler, Lillian Allen and many nieces and nephews. She was predeceased by parents James and Sarah Wilson and brother Ronald. Mother and father-in-law Mae and Jay Sadler, in-laws Wilford Cotton, Percy Parker, Jack Stinson and Isabel Simpson. A memorial service will be scheduled at a later date. The family would like to thank the staff at Seven Oaks Hospital for their care and concern and the many visitors that cheered and brightened her day. In lieu of flowers, a donation may be made to the charity of your choice. Arrangements entrusted to: Morris Funeral Home 204-746-2451
